How Often Should You Schedule Maintenance?

Most automotive experts recommend adhering to a routine maintenance schedule, typically every 3,000 to 5,000 miles. However, this can vary based on your vehicle make and model, as well as driving conditions. Here are some key aspects to consider:

  • Oil Changes: Changing your oil regularly is vital for engine health. Newer vehicles may require less frequent oil changes, so consult your owner’s manual.
  • Tire Rotation: Rotating your tires every 6,000 to 8,000 miles can ensure even wear and extend tire life.
  • Brake Inspection: It’s essential to check your brakes every 10,000 miles to ensure safety.
  • Understanding Common Auto Repairs

    Discerning common auto repairs can help you recognize when it’s time to seek professional help. Among the most frequently required services are:

  • Brake Repairs: Whether it’s replacing pads or rotors, seeing signs of wear can prevent accidents.
  • Transmission Services: Regular fluid checks and exchanges can prolong the life of your transmission.
  • Exhaust Repairs: A failing exhaust system not only affects performance but can also pose environmental risks.

    Finding a Reliable Auto Repair Service

    When it comes to selecting an auto repair service, the quality and reliability of the shop are crucial. It’s advisable to look for shops that:

  • Have Certified Mechanics: ASE (Automotive Service Excellence) certification indicates that the mechanics have undergone rigorous training.
  • Provide Warranty on Repairs: A good repair shop will offer a warranty on parts and labor, ensuring peace of mind.
  • Receive Positive Reviews: Online reviews and word-of-mouth referrals can help you gauge the reputation of a service provider.

    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

    What types of used cars can I find under $5,000 in San Antonio?

    In San Antonio, you can find a variety of used cars under $5,000, including sedans, compact cars, and SUVs. Popular brands often available in this price range include Honda, Toyota, Ford, and Chevrolet, with options varying from older models to higher-mileage newer cars.

    Are older used cars still reliable?

    Yes, older used cars can still be reliable if they have been well maintained. It’s crucial to check the vehicle history report, service records, and have a mechanic inspect the car before purchasing to ensure it is in good working condition.

    How can I determine if a used car is a good deal?

    To determine if a used car is a good deal, compare its price to the market value using resources like Kelley Blue Book or Edmunds. Additionally, analyzing the car’s condition, mileage, and maintenance history can help you make an informed decision.

    What should I look for when inspecting a used car?

    When inspecting a used car, pay attention to the exterior and interior condition, listen for unusual noises during a test drive, check the tire wear, and examine the engine for any leaks or corrosion. It’s also beneficial to have a trusted mechanic perform a thorough inspection.
